What Are NFTs?
Non-Fungible Tokens, or NFTs, are unique digital assets verified using blockchain technology. Unlike cryptocurrencies such as Bitcoin or Ethereum, NFTs are not interchangeable; each token has distinct properties and value.
This uniqueness makes NFTs ideal for representing ownership of digital collectibles, art, and experiences.
Current Use Cases
Travel companies are beginning to explore NFTs for various applications. For instance, airlines can issue NFT boarding passes that serve as collectible items, adding a layer of excitement to travel.
Hotels can offer NFT room keys that provide access to exclusive benefits or experiences, enhancing customer loyalty and engagement.
Benefits of NFTs for Travelers
NFTs allow travelers to own a piece of their journey. Imagine collecting digital stamps from each destination visited, creating a virtual passport filled with memories.
Moreover, NFTs can enhance loyalty programs, allowing travelers to trade or sell their unique tokens, providing real value beyond traditional rewards.
Challenges and Considerations
While the potential for NFTs in travel is vast, there are challenges to consider. The environmental impact of blockchain technology and the need for user-friendly platforms are significant barriers to widespread adoption.
Additionally, the volatile nature of the NFT market can make investment in these digital collectibles risky for travelers.
